Enhance Air Quality

An unclean flue could negatively impact the inside air quality in your residence. When you ignite the blaze, particulate matter and creosote accumulate and have the potential to release harmful substances into your air. Exposure to these contaminants can be especially so risky for people with respiratory issues or sensitivities. Regular flue cleanings can help in the elimination of harmful impurities, enhancing the purity of the air, and promising a more healthful living environment for yourself and those you care about.

Improve Energy Efficiency

Maintaining peak energy efficiency in your residence demands the unobstructed flue. When soot and creosote gather in the flue, these deposits can impede the flow of air, resulting in suboptimal performance of the fireplace or wood-burning stove. Such a situation means you'll be required to burn additional combustibles to create the same level of thermal energy, leading in elevated heating bills. By regularly sweeping the flue, you have the potential to clear away these, making sure that the heating system functions at its optimum performance, in the long run reducing you and your family money.

Stop Carbon Monoxide Poisoning

Carbon monoxide is a transparent and scentless substance formed when fuel is partially consumed. A clogged or soiled flue might block proper carbon monoxide discharge, enabling it to gather inside of the residence. Increased levels of carbon monoxide in the atmosphere can be excessively unsafe, even lethal. Regular flue cleanings have the potential to help make sure no no impediments or stoppages that could cause carbon monoxide buildup, consequently ensuring you safe.

Chimney Safety Tips

Your fireplace provides a gorgeous enhancement to your appearance of the residence, however it might also constitute risks if you have not dedicated the time to verify that the chimney is in proper shape. Follow the steps here to guarantee the safety of your flue:

Schedule a Chimney Inspection

The initial measures in guaranteeing the chimney is secure is is to have it inspected and cleared in case necessary. Given that the examiner will be in a position to advise you about the state of the flue, you can avoid potential blazes or carbon monoxide risks.

Cover Your Chimney

Secure your chimney whenever you're not using the fireplace. A high-quality cap is normally composed of stainless steel that resists rust, stopping rust. Such a cap serves to block pests, dirt, and plant matter from obstructing the normal gas.

Keep It Simple

Be sure to keep a proper distance between the decor and the fireplace. Any heat holds potential of ignite with time.

Install a Screen or a Door

Adding screens or glass doors in front of your home's fireplace can help manage sparks and avoid them clear of any carpet or decor. When you have little ones, it can add a further layer of safety. For glass panel doors, always avoid leave them shut during a fire.

Detectors That Work

Double-check that your smoke and carbon monoxide detectors are up-to-date and functional. Install the detectors on your ceiling, because it's the most probable spot for the ascent of smoke or CO.

Fire Starter

Make use of a fire-lighting tool specifically designed to be used inside a fireplace. Employing forbidden to use apply fuel, fluid lighter, or a charcoal grill lighter. Such kinds of lighters have the potential to trigger flames to get overly huge, increasing the risk of a. Furthermore, some of them are regarded as an accelerant, which may leave remnants within the flue, perhaps leading to an inside of your flue.

Clean Outside the Chimney

While the interior of the inside of the flue is commonly discussed since it is the most part, the region surrounding the flue is as vital. Ensure that the surroundings around your home's flue is neat and that there are branches obstructing the upper section.

Maintain a Small Flame

Refrain from burning an overly large quantity of firewood simultaneously. The location for combusting wood is on a grate toward the rear section of the fireplace. Burning firewood at one time can result in accumulated creosote with time, which might lead to chimney stack cracking.

Keep an eye on the Fire

Do not ever leave a unattended flame. Ignited particles and firewood pieces have the potential to tumble from the grate while it is burning, and these could fly. This holds the potential to start a fire.
